Prestwick International Airport Train Station ensures accessibility is a priority, featuring step-free access throughout. There are lifts that connect covered walkways to both platforms, making it convenient for all passengers. While ticket machines are unavailable on-site, smartcard validators are accessible for easy travel support. Furthermore, the station provides induction loop systems for the hearing impaired and has helpful customer service points for additional support.
Although there are no waiting lounges or cycle facilities, waiting rooms are available on the platforms, along with seating areas for comfort. Toilets are located inside the airport building, but there are no baby changing facilities. Security is dependable with CCTV installed around the premises, adding a layer of safety for passengers and their belongings.
The station might not have a large selection of retail options, but refreshment facilities are available to keep you energized during your travels. Parking is effortless with the airport's parking facilities, boasting 910 spaces, including 20 accessible spaces. Watford North might be small, but it is mighty in convenience. While the station doesn't feature a ticket office, ticket machines are available for collecting pre-purchased tickets, making the start of your journey hassle-free. For assistance, the station is equipped with help points and information screens, yet it's important to note there is no staff present for personal assistance. Step-free access is comprehensive, classifying it as an A-category station, meaning passengers with reduced mobility can access all platforms without barriers.
Unfortunately, there are no refreshment facilities, ATMs, or waiting rooms available, so travelers might want to stock up on essentials before arrival. Moreover, the station doesn’t have any CCTV coverage or luggage storage, adding to the importance of keeping your belongings secure. Bicycle enthusiasts will find limited storage with places for six bikes but should be mindful as the area is not sheltered.
